1969 Ford Zephyr vs. 2007 Seat Alhambra
To start off, 2007 Seat Alhambra is newer by 38 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1969 Ford Zephyr.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1969 Ford Zephyr would be higher. At 1,995 cc (4 cylinders), 1969 Ford Zephyr is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 Seat Alhambra (113 HP @ 4000 RPM) has 32 more horse power than 1969 Ford Zephyr. (81 HP @ 4750 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2007 Seat Alhambra should accelerate faster than 1969 Ford Zephyr.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2007 Seat Alhambra weights approximately 416 kg more than 1969 Ford Zephyr.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 1969 Ford Zephyr is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1969 Ford Zephyr.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2007 Seat Alhambra,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2007 Seat Alhambra (310 Nm @ 1900 RPM) has 157 more torque (in Nm) than 1969 Ford Zephyr. (153 Nm @ 2750 RPM). This means 2007 Seat Alhambra will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1969 Ford Zephyr.
Compare all specifications:
1969 Ford Zephyr | 2007 Seat Alhambra | |
Make | Ford | Seat |
Model | Zephyr | Alhambra |
Year Released | 1969 | 2007 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1995 cc | 1896 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 81 HP | 113 HP |
Engine RPM | 4750 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Torque | 153 Nm | 310 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2750 RPM | 1900 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 93.7 mm | 79.5 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 72.4 mm | 95.5 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.0:1 | 18.0: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Diesel |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1250 kg | 1666 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4710 mm | 4640 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1820 mm | 1820 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1490 mm | 1710 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2930 mm | 2850 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 41 L | 70 L |
